Bathroom Fan Replacement in Denver, CO
Bathroom fan replacement services involve removing outdated or malfunctioning exhaust fans and installing new units to improve ventilation and air quality in bathrooms. These projects typically cover both simple replacements of existing fans and more extensive upgrades, such as installing higher-capacity or quieter models. Homeowners often seek this service to address issues like excess humidity, mold growth, or inadequate ventilation, especially in bathrooms without windows or with older fans that no longer operate effectively.
Property owners should consider the size and type of bathroom fan needed for their space, as well as compatibility with existing wiring and ductwork. Understanding the noise level, energy efficiency, and airflow capacity of different models can help in selecting the right replacement. It’s also useful to know whether any modifications to the ceiling or venting system are required to ensure proper installation and optimal performance of the new fan.

Bathroom Fan Replacement Questions
When should a bathroom f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the fan is noisy, not functioning properly, or has visible damage that affects performance.
Can a bathroom fan be upgraded to a more efficient model? Yes, upgrading to a newer, more energy-efficient fan can improve ventilation and reduce energy use.
What signs indicate a bathroom fan needs replacement? Common signs include persistent noise, inadequate airflow, and frequent electrical issues or flickering lights.
Is it necessary to replace the entire fan or just the motor? It depends on the issue; often, replacing the motor is sufficient, but if the fan housing or blades are damaged, full replacement may be needed.
